Exchange Program Coordinator

Responsibilities

  • Guide participants through the application and visa processes, monitoring their progress, facilitating cultural exchange, and ensuring they meet federal regulations and host company objectives for their practical, temporary training in the US
  • Create and manage essential documents, monitor participant compliance with J-1 visa regulations and program policies through written reports, and address any issues or concerns
  • Serve as a primary contact for international partners, schools, interns and host companies, using various communication methods like email, video calls, and texts to provide support and guidance.
  • Liaise with the US Department of State and the sponsoring organization to ensure all program requirements are met.
  • Manage a caseload of J-1 interns, serving as the main point of contact from initial contact through program completion, assisting with applications, visas, arrival, and departure.


Requirements

  • International (exchange ) experience is desirable. 
  • Strong interpersonal and communication skills.
  • Excellent organizational skills with the ability to manage multiple priorities effectively.
